Most likely ABS sensor. You can try cleaning them. Sometimes the magnetic pickup gets small metal debri stuck to it from the road. I believe its just a 10mm screw and it wiggles out. Just spray some brake cleaner on it and wipe it well with a rag. That would be my best guess if the problem happens intermitently. If it is still doing it its best to take it to a shop and see if there are any stored ABS codes. That will help them poinpoint which of the sensors are defective if any.
